Unless Yahweh Builds the House

A Song of Ascents. Of Solomon.

127 Unless Yahweh (A)builds the house,
They labor in vain who build it;
Unless Yahweh (B)watches the city,
The watchman keeps awake in vain.
It is in vain that you rise up early,
That you sit out late,
O you who (C)eat the bread of [a]painful labors;
For in this manner, He gives (D)sleep to His (E)beloved.

Behold, (F)children are [b]an inheritance of Yahweh,
The (G)fruit of the womb is a reward.
Like arrows in the hand of a (H)warrior,
So are the children of one’s youth.
How (I)blessed is the man who fills his quiver with them;
(J)They will not be ashamed
When they (K)speak with enemies (L)in the gate.
